The Healing Hearts Initiative is a comprehensive movement designed to support survivors of human trafficking, domestic violence, and young adults aging out of foster care. Our goal is to provide a holistic approach to healing—offering immediate crisis intervention, mental health support, life skills training, safe housing, and long-term empowerment.
We recognize that true healing goes beyond short-term relief. That’s why we focus on stability, self-sufficiency, and personal growth, helping survivors regain control of their lives and thrive.
We serve individuals who have faced trauma, instability, and significant life challenges. These individuals often struggle with safety concerns, mental health issues, financial insecurity, and a lack of support systems
Human trafficking survivors often escape dangerous situations with nothing but the clothes on their backs. We provide a safe space where they can begin the healing process and regain control over their lives.
Domestic violence survivors need support in breaking free from abusive situations and rebuilding their lives. We connect them with safe housing, emotional support, and practical resources to ensure long-term stability.
For many young adults leaving the foster care system, the transition to independence is overwhelming. We help them secure stable housing, find employment, and develop essential life skills so they can build a successful future.
Provide safe housing for at least 50 survivors within the first year of the program.
Facilitate 12 counseling sessions and support groups each month, reaching at least 100 participants annually.
Host 6 life skills workshops per year, with 80% of participants reporting increased confidence in their independence.

The Healing Hearts Initiative was born out of my personal experiences and a deep desire to address the gaps in support for survivors of human trafficking, domestic violence, and young adults aging out of the foster care system. As someone who has witnessed firsthand the emotional, financial, and societal challenges faced by individuals in these vulnerable situations, I felt compelled to create a safe space where healing, empowerment, and independence could truly be achieved.
I founded the Healing Hearts Initiative because I saw how often survivors are left to navigate life on their own, without the necessary resources or support systems to rebuild their lives. Many face barriers to housing, counseling, education, and life skills training, which are crucial for long-term stability. I wanted to create an organization that not only addressed these barriers but also provided a holistic approach to recovery—one that focuses on mental health, personal growth, and community reintegration.
The inspiration for this nonprofit stems from my belief that everyone deserves a chance to reclaim their life, regardless of their past. I have always been passionate about advocacy and social work, and through my professional experiences, I recognized the urgent need for a comprehensive program that meets survivors where they are and helps them move forward.
The Healing Hearts Initiative is more than just a nonprofit—it’s a mission to restore hope, dignity, and independence to those who have endured unimaginable hardships. My goal is to empower individuals to break the cycle of trauma, build a strong foundation for their future, and thrive in a supportive and understanding community.
